January 3: Jay Croucher (@croucherJD), Connor Rogers (@ConnorJRogers) and Lawrence Jackson (@LordDontLose) highlight key injuries for teams still vying for playoff berths and positioning, as well as analyze how to approach games with postseason implications versus matchups that do not in Week 18. The trio also highlight if Jordan Love and Jayden Reed can keep clicking on Sunday before debating whether to start or sit Tua Tagovailoa, Derrick Henry, Terry McLaurin, Jordan Addison and others in “Keep it Open or Close it Out.” They wrap up with insight on why they’ve circled Vikings-Lions, Bills-Dolphins and Jets-Patriots on their betting card.(02:50) – Rotoworld Player News: Analyzing injuries to Alvin Kamara, Raheem Mostert and others entering Week 18 + how to approach games impacting the playoff picture(14:55) – Who’s Eatin’ Good: Examining Jordan Love, Jayden Reed and James Conner entering next season(27:00) – Keep it Open or Close it Out: Debating to start or sit Tua Tagovailoa, Tony Pollard, Derrick Henry, Ty Chandler, Terry McLaurin, Jordan Addison and Dalton Kincaid(47:00) – Last Call: Highlighting spreads and money lines in Vikings-Lions, Bills-Dolphins and Jets-Patriots
